В настоящее время вы можете увидеть, как идет предварительная загрузка, обновив страницу.
Но если предварительная загрузка завершается между обновлениями, следующая загрузка страницы полностью удалит уведомление.
Я остаюсь с мыслью: «Это закончилось? Что-то пошло не так? Сколько страниц было кэшировано в итоге?»
Было бы неплохо иметь уведомление «Предварительная загрузка завершена: x страниц в кэше», чтобы пользователь знал, когда это будет сделано.
Привет, Люси,
Я заметил, что вы упомянули несколько раз, но соответствует ли это? Вот что я вижу, когда пытаюсь воспроизвести - https://jmp.sh/X5gZqh6
По вашей демонстрации я не могу сказать, делаем ли мы то же самое. Если вы обновитесь снова после просмотра 24 страниц, вы больше не увидите уведомление.
Даже если вы неоднократно видите одно и то же уведомление о 24 страницах, что указывает на то, что оно заполнено, а не застряло?
Отсутствует «обновление для прогресса», но отсутствие текста не является сильным индикатором :)
Этот запрос связан - https://github.com/wp-media/wp-rocket/issues/1867
Обсудил с Люси.
По крайней мере, мы могли бы изменить уведомление, указав Preload Complete
.
Чтобы в последнем уведомлении было написано Preload Complete: 24 pages have been cached
Добавление отметки времени, упомянутой в # 1867, если мы в конечном итоге это сделаем, добавит больше информации.
Мы также можем изменить цвет уведомления, оставив зеленый цвет для завершения, но использовать синий для выполнения.
Самый полезный комментарий
Мы также можем изменить цвет уведомления, оставив зеленый цвет для завершения, но использовать синий для выполнения.